Racine weather in January (Wisconsin, United States of America)

In January, Racine generally has very low temperatures and moderate snowfall. January is a winter month. Throughout the day, temperatures typically settle at around -1°C. But by evening, they drop to around -9°C. Typically, it's the chilliest month of the year. Making it a great time for staying indoors and enjoying the warmth. Racine in January usually receives moderate snowfall, averaging around 43 mm for the month. It's the month receiving the least amount of rain. As the days go by, you can expect fewer clouds and less precipitation. This makes it an ideal time for outdoor activities and events that might be disrupted by wetter conditions in other months. Typically around 10 days of snowfall is expected.
The area experiences a moderate amount of sunshine, with approximately 138 hours of sunlight expected. This makes it neither too gloomy nor overly bright.
If you prefer dry days with pleasant temperatures, January may not be the ideal month to visit Racine. July, August and September typically offer the most optimal weather. In contrast, January, February, March, April, November and December tend to have less optimal conditions.

So, what should you wear in Racine in January?
Visitors traveling to Racine should plan on bringing winter clothes, snow boots and a warm winter coat. There will be periods of snow.What To Do
